Employee vs. Employer Contributions
Contributions made by the employee (your spouse) are generally 100% divisible in a QDRO. However, employer contributions may be subject to a vesting schedule. That means if the employee is not fully vested at the time of the divorce, part of the account (typically the employer match) may not yet belong to the participant—and therefore cannot be divided.
It’s important to request a vesting schedule from the plan administrator or employer to determine if there are any unvested funds that may affect your QDRO award.
